Mysql 两个RDS端点共享相同的VPN。可以从流浪者箱连接到一个,但不能连接到另一个

Mysql 两个RDS端点共享相同的VPN。可以从流浪者箱连接到一个,但不能连接到另一个,mysql,ubuntu,vagrant,vpn,amazon-rds,Mysql,Ubuntu,Vagrant,Vpn,Amazon Rds,我有两个RDS端点:qa-cxx-vpc.xxxxxxxxxx.us-east-1.RDS.amazonaws.com和qa-dxx-vpc.xxxxxxxxxx.us-east-1.RDS.amazonaws.com 当我用ssh连接到我的流浪者邮箱并尝试mysql-uusername2015-ppassword2015-hqa-dxx-vpc.xxxxxxxxxxx.us-east-1.rds.amazonaws.com时,我可以登录到mysql。如果关闭主机vpn客户端,则无法登录。但是,

我有两个RDS端点:qa-cxx-vpc.xxxxxxxxxx.us-east-1.RDS.amazonaws.com和qa-dxx-vpc.xxxxxxxxxx.us-east-1.RDS.amazonaws.com


当我用ssh连接到我的流浪者邮箱并尝试mysql-uusername2015-ppassword2015-hqa-dxx-vpc.xxxxxxxxxxx.us-east-1.rds.amazonaws.com时,我可以登录到mysql。如果关闭主机vpn客户端,则无法登录。但是,当我使用主机登录VPN,并尝试我的其他RDS端点mysql-uusername2015-ppassword2015-hqa-cxx-vpc.XXXXXXXXXX.us-east-1.RDS.amazonaws.com和qa-dxx-vpc.XXXXXXXXXXXXXX.us-east-1.RDS.amazonaws.com时,我无法登录。当我在我的主机上时,我可以同时登录到这两个主机。我做错了什么?

默认情况下,VirtualBox将NAT配置为使用10.0.2.x。RDS主机IP地址在相同的10.0.2.x IP范围内,因此发生冲突。加入 vb.customize[modifyvm,:id,-natnet1,192.168.100/24]到Vagrant文件,我现在可以从Vagrant访问并使用我的远程RDS实例